Ingredients for Cinnamon Roll French Toast
Gather these items:
- 1 cup whole milk
- 2 large egg yolks
- ¼ cup granulated sugar
- 1½ tablespoons cornstarch
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 loaf brioche or soft milk bread
- 2 large eggs
- ½ cup whole milk
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- ¼ te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 2 tablespoons butter (for cooking)
- Powdered sugar, for serving
- Warm vanilla sauce or maple syrup, for serving
How to Make Cinnamon Roll French Toast Step-by-Step
- Step 1: In a saucepan, whisk together 1 cup whole milk, 2 large egg yolks, ¼ cup granulated sugar, and 1½ tablespoons cornstarch until smooth. Cook over medium heat, stirring constantly, until thick and creamy. Remove from heat, stir in 1 teaspoon vanilla extract, and let cool slightly until spoonable.
- Step 2: Cut the brioche into thick 1½-inch cubes. Carefully create a small pocket in each cube and fill with the vanilla custard to create a soft, gooey center.
- Step 3: In a bowl, whisk together 2 large eggs, ½ cup whole milk, 1 teaspoon vanilla extract, and ¼ teaspoon ground cinnamon until smooth and well combined.
- Step 4: Heat 2 tablespoons butter in a skillet over medium heat. Lightly dip each filled bread cube into the French toast mixture without soaking, then place in the skillet. Cook, turning on all sides, until deep golden brown and caramelized.
- Step 5: Transfer the Cinnamon Roll French Toast Bites to a serving plate. Dust generously with powdered sugar and drizzle with warm vanilla sauce or maple syrup. Serve immediately while creamy and melty.
Pro Tips for the Perfect Cinnamon Roll French Toast
Keep these in mind:
- Use stale bread for better texture; it absorbs the custard without becoming soggy.
- For more flavor, try adding a pinch of nutmeg or a splash of maple extract to the custard.
- Cook on medium-low heat to ensure even cooking and avoid burning.

How to Store and Reheat Cinnamon Roll French Toast
Leftover Cinnamon Roll French Toast Bites can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, place them in a toaster oven or microwave until warmed through. This makes for a quick breakfast option throughout the week!
Frequently Asked Questions About Cinnamon Roll French Toast
What’s the secret to perfect Cinnamon Roll French Toast?
The key to perfect Cinnamon Roll French Toast is ensuring the custard mixture is well-combined and not overly soaked into the bread. Lightly dipping the bread will keep it from becoming soggy.
Can I make Cinnamon Roll French Toast ahead of time?
Yes! You can prepare the custard and fill the bread cubes in advance. Just store them in the refrigerator and cook them fresh in the morning for a delightful breakfast.
How do I avoid common mistakes with Cinnamon Roll French Toast?
Avoid soaking the bread too long in the custard mixture, as this can lead to soggy bites. Make sure to cook them on medium heat for the best texture.
